1st problem with the Ista Breeze I1500
part three of a multi part series showing a problem that popped up during a casual inspection of the wind turbine.
I was able to get the trench dug the conduit in the ground and the trench covered.

@justinduncan2480
@justinduncan2480 3 жыл бұрын
lol if it makes you feel better I haven’t been able to keep those bolts in the stub. I haven’t had them in for about 4 months...thats why i slotted my stub and clamp it down with exhaust clamps. The bolts would work great IF the stub tower was a perfect fit for the turbine’s yoke. I’d have had to machine one and it cost too much. I learned after the fact that they have a four bolt flange adapter...had i known that i would have gone that route.

@veggitarianredneck
@veggitarianredneck 2 жыл бұрын
@@larrymoore5811 Hey no problem. So I used 1 1/2 pipe but looking back I should have used 2" pipe. I have a video showing how I reinforced it. I initially screwed the pipe together which would have worked out just fine but my tower wires were not tight enough and one of the couplers broke sending the whole thing to the ground. So the upper most coupler I eventually welded.
